TOMORROW’S WARRIORS AT WE OUT HERE: WHERE THE FUTURE TAKES THE STAGE

136 young artists. 23 line-ups. Four days. One extraordinary Tomorrow’s Warriors Big Top. Those numbers tell part of the story of our weekend at We Out Here. The rest lives in the music. In the crowds spilling out of the tent, the musicians cheering each other on from side stage, and audiences discovering artists they'll be talking about long after the festival wristbands come off.

MARKING THE SAD PASSING OF ‘UNCLE’ HARRY BROWN

It is with the deepest shock and sadness that we learned yesterday of the passing of ‘Uncle’ Harry Brown. We are heartbroken. As trombonist and Musical Director of Jazz Jamaica, Harry was very much part of our family.
